Organization Castro-Mission Health Center.
Address 3850 17th Street. San Francisco CA 94114

Description Provides comprehensive primary and preventive health care services including dedicated children's clinics, a teen clinic and women's clinics. Offers immunizations and flu shots; screenings for diabetes, colo-rectal cancer, hepatitis, tuberculosis, and hypertension. Provides pregnancy testing. Public Health nurses make home visits and offer health education in schools and at community sites. Offers the Dimensions Program for lesbian, gay, bisexual, transgender and questioning individuals 12 to 25 years of age. The Dimensions Program provides primary health care, individual counseling, case management and health education. Provides comprehensive outpatient AIDS treatment services. Offers the HIV Anonymous Testing Program under the direction of the AIDS Health Project on Wednesday. Serves as an enrollment site for the AIDS Drug Assistance Program (ADAP). Provides sexually transmitted disease (STD) testing and treatment.
Participates in the Department of Public Health's Breast and Cervical Cancer Control Program. Provides pap smears and breast examinations. See separate database record for more information.
Eligibility San Francisco resident.
Fee Varies with service; sliding scale; Accepts Medi-Cal, Medicare, private insurance and other third party payers.
Application Apply by phone; appointment necessary for clinics.
